Edna Rose Fanning, 97, of Topeka, passed away Monday, August 29, 2022.

She was born December 7, 1924, in Topeka, Kansas, the daughter of George and Ella (Schendel) Rice. She was a 1941 graduate of Meriden High School.

She was a member of Meriden Community Church, and the Meriden “Get Together” garden club and former member of TARC.

Edna married Ronald Fanning on February 19, 1944 at the Seaman Congregational Church parsonage. He preceded her in death on July 30, 1998.

Survivors include three children, Gary (Marcia) Fanning of Derby, KS, Dr. Robert “Bob” (Peggy) Fanning of Wamego, KS and Ronda (John) Stadler of Tecumseh, KS; 10 grandchildren; Joe (Valerie), Meaghan (Andy), Kasey (Dustin), John (Kate), Jonathan, Rochelle, Preston (Jessica), Joshua (Miranda), January (Bryan) and Jordan; great-grandchildren, Ella, Landon, Drew, Weston, Haydon, Addison, Parker, Garrett, Paige, Elliott, Liam, Kiley, Madison, Emma, Victoria, Alexander, Emile, Charley, Blakely Paige, Avery, Grace and Michael; sister-in-law, Margaret Fanning of Lakin, Kansas and many nieces and nephews.

She was preceded in death by two of her children, sons Merlyn (Butch) and William (Bill) Fanning; her parents, George Cam Rice and Ella Schendel Rice; her sister, Grace Parks and three brothers, Shirley, Norris and Clarence “Bud” Rice.

Edna enjoyed working in her beautiful flower gardens, embroidering, making pies and being with family members and friends.
